Faster cholinergic REM sleep induction in euthymic patients with primary affective illness
Summary
Patients with primary affective illness show a faster onset of rapid eye movement sleep when given arecoline, a cholinergic agonist. This suggests a potentially supersensitive cholinergic system in these patients, even during remission.

Background:
- Cholinergic system involvement in affective disorders is increasingly recognized.
- Primary affective illness (e.g., depression, bipolar disorder) is associated with various neurobiological alterations.
Purpose of the Study:
- To investigate the cholinergic system's sensitivity in patients with primary affective illness during remission.
- To compare the effects of a cholinergic agonist on sleep onset in patients versus healthy controls.
Main Methods:
- Administered arecoline, a muscarinic receptor agonist, to patients with primary affective illness in remission and age/sex-matched healthy controls.
- Monitored and compared the latency to rapid eye movement (REM) sleep onset between groups.
Main Results:
- Arecoline significantly shortened the latency to REM sleep in patients with primary affective illness compared to controls.
- This effect was observed even when participants were in clinical remission.
Conclusions:
- Patients with primary affective illness may possess a supersensitive cholinergic system.
- This cholinergic supersensitivity might persist even in the absence of overt clinical symptoms.
- Findings suggest a potential neurobiological marker for primary affective illness.
